ApNano Materials is a nanotechnology company that pioneered the commercialization of inorganic fullerene-like tungsten disulfide (IF-WS2) nanoparticles, originally discovered at the Weizmann Institute of Science. The company's core technology, marketed under the brand NanoLub, provides advanced lubrication and coating solutions that significantly reduce friction and wear in mechanical systems. Within the life sciences sector, ApNano's materials are utilized to enhance the performance of medical devices, orthodontic wires, and dental tools by providing superior lubricity and biocompatibility. The company's proprietary manufacturing process allows for the production of these unique structures at an industrial scale. ApNano was later integrated into Nanotech Industrial Solutions (NIS), which continues to develop these nanomaterials for diverse industrial and medical applications.
